A KwaZulu-Natal teacher will appear in court on Friday following allegations that he had raped and threatened an 11-year-old pupil at the school.
Police spokesperson Captain Nqobile Gwala said the 53-year-old teacher was expected to appear in the Madadeni Magistrate’s Court on a charge of rape.
“It is alleged that on 9 June 2021 an 11-year-old girl was at a school in Madadeni when she was raped by one of the teachers in the school toilets. She was threatened [with death] should she report the matter to anyone,” she said.

Gwala said the child informed her mother about the incident and a case of rape was opened at the Madadeni police station.
“The docket was transferred to Newcastle Family Violence, Child Protection and Sexual Offences (FCS) Unit for further investigation. The suspect was arrested yesterday morning (Thursday) by the FCS Unit.”
